DEXTROSE is produced by an enzymatically hydrolysis from wheat starch respectively maize starch. Followed by a raffination, crystallisation and drying process. A Dextrose mono-hydrate is produced through several crystallisation steps.
DEXTROSE FEED contains a min. 99 % glucose on dry matter.
The sweetness of DEXTROSE FEED is compared to Saccharose mild.
DEXTROSE FEED is a very suitable to supply young animals (especially piglets) with easy disposable energy.
In conclusion is DEXTROSE FEED a highly digestible energy carrier which also improves the acceptance of the finished feed due to its typical taste.
